Originally, it was about discussing the launch of the employment campaign. Considering recent events, the focus of this gathering shifted mainly towards the weather and, more specifically, the future of the valley.


This weekend, at the initiative of the PCF 06, a gathering took place on the square of the south station to address the emergencies of the department. “We are in this moment, which is why we organized this initiative. Everyone comes, everyone promises… we had the president, grand declarations, but the time for reconstruction is going to be very, very long,” explains Robert Injey, head of the PCF in Nice.

Three strong ideas emerged from the various speeches:

  • Solidarity. It exists when an event of an exceptional nature occurs and must be the cornerstone of any economic and social policy according to the trade unionists.
  • The importance of public services. During the COVID crisis, the hard work of hospital staff, public hospitals, and retirement home staff saved many lives, often under very delicate conditions. Again, with the bad weather, we can observe the leading role of public services on the ground. Whether it’s the firefighters, police, army, health services… all are mobilized to help the victims in the valley.
  • Climate change: “All of this is a consequence of the climate crisis. For several years now, we have had exceptional weather episodes affecting the department. This year, it’s the Roya and the Vésubie. We are reaching precipitation levels that we have never seen before. Today, it’s not about rebuilding quickly to restore what we had before but rather building differently so that people can live there for decades to come,” urges Robert Injey.

Regarding funding, the PCF proposes relying on public money, European aid, or even local governments. “These disasters must not be repeated, and for that, we must invest wisely without repeating the mistakes of recent years, without making short-sighted savings that end up costing us dearly.”
